Storm Ciara has forced more sailings to be cancelled today.
The Steam Packet Company has confirmed the 8.45am service to Heysham and its return at 2.15pm won't go ahead due to the continued poor conditions.
It comes after the bad weather forced officials to call off crossings which were due to take place over the weekend.
Meanwhile, a final decision on tonight's 7.45pm Ben-my-Chree voyage to the Lancashire port will be made by 5.30pm this evening.
